R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Receives or initiates communication with employer groups, insurance carriers, and vendors about claims, eligibility, billing, contracts, and legislation.

  • Works with the Client Manager as a liaison to coordinate changes, renewals, and new group business.

  • Acts as the point person for groups and consultants.

  • May assist with on-site enrollment meetings at the group location as requested.

  • Helps with onboarding new groups and renewing existing ones.

  • Prepares and produces reports with the Client Manager.

  • Maintains and updates information in internal systems and CRM.

  • Assists with audits like eligibility and carrier records when needed.

  • Travels locally to client meetings and events as required.

  • Performs other duties as assigned by management.


QUALIFICATIONS

  • One to three years of group medical insurance experience involving functions related to plan administration or equivalent combination of education and insurance experience

  • Working knowledge of medical terminology, group medical insurance terminology, and regulatory requirements and restrictions

  • Experience with self-funded and fully insured large and small group plans

  • Ability to read and interpret contract documents and the ability to write routine reports and correspondence with assistance from a senior level member of the Client Services team

  • Proficient verbal and written communication skills as well as strong organizational and customer service skills

  • Proficient PC and data entry skills with experience in MS Word, Excel and Outlook

  • Basic mathematical aptitude

  • Bachelor’s Degree in Business or related field or the equivalent combination of education and experience
